The government’s recently published guidance on Anti-Muslim Hostility laid great emphasis on freedom of speech, the right to ridicule or insult a religion or belief, including Islam, and its portrayal in a manner that some of its adherents might find disrespectful or scandalous.

Given that this is the case, one could be forgiven for thinking that Starmer might have exercised the “tolerance” that he so frequently extolls when describing his vision for Britain, and celebrated the ability of Nick Timothy MP freely to express his views on X concerning the Islamic rituals hosted by Muslim Mayor Siddiq Khan in Trafalgar Square this week.

In his own words, Timothy said: “Too many are too polite to say this. But mass ritual prayer in public places is an act of domination”. In particular, he referred to the Islamic call to prayer  (the adhan) which had been broadcast over the square at the time.
